摘要
This paper presents a new shape design sensitivity analysis for the general superconducting system. The proposed method takes into account the nonlinear dependence of the critical current on the maximum magnetic flux density in the sensitivity calculation. The J(c) - B-m curve of the superconducting material is interpolated from the measurement data. The design of a magnetic resonance imaging superconducting solenoid is given as a numerical example.
